Nature Is a Human Right: Why We're Fighting for Green in a Grey World | Ellen Miles
1 post | 1 read | 2 to read
Having access to natural, green spaces is vital to our physical and mental wellbeing. But, as urban development spreads, grey has become the new green. Already, concrete outweighs every tree, bush and shrub on Earth. Nature deprivation (…more)
